Here and Now is this introspective drama that takes its time, really immersing you in the quiet complexities of a marriage at a crossroads. The summer setting creates a hazy, almost nostalgic atmosphere, where every glance and silence speaks volumes. The pacing feels deliberate, allowing the audience to sit with the couple's tension and reminiscences. It's not just about their love story; it digs into themes of memory and regret. The performances are raw and genuine, capturing the essence of two people trying to find their way back to each other—or decide if they should part ways. There's a simplicity to its practical effects, focusing more on the emotional landscape than flashy techniques, which makes it distinctively powerful.
This film has had a bit of a rocky journey in terms of distribution, with limited releases that make it a bit of a hidden gem. More recent interest has surfaced among collectors, especially those who appreciate nuanced storytelling over commercial appeal. Formats are scarce, and it has been released on DVD in a few regions, but it seems like an elusive title for anyone looking to hunt down a copy. Overall, it has piqued the interest of those who value character-driven narratives and subtle emotional depth.
